Description

An issue was discovered in NLnet Labs Routinator 0.1.0 through 0.7.1. It allows remote attackers to bypass intended access restrictions or to cause a denial of service on dependent routing systems by strategically withholding RPKI Route Origin Authorisation ".roa" files or X509 Certificate Revocation List files from the RPKI relying party's view.
